CAS 85951-61-7
:(R)-2-Amino-7-hydroxytetralin
Description:
(R)-2-Amino-7-hydroxytetralin is a chemical compound characterized by its specific stereochemistry and functional groups. It features a tetralin core, which is a bicyclic structure composed of a benzene ring fused to a cyclopentane ring. The presence of an amino group (-NH2) and a hydroxyl group (-OH) contributes to its reactivity and solubility in polar solvents. This compound is often studied for its potential pharmacological properties, particularly in relation to its interactions with neurotransmitter systems, such as dopamine receptors. The (R) configuration indicates the specific three-dimensional arrangement of atoms around the chiral center, which can significantly influence the biological activity of the molecule. Additionally, (R)-2-Amino-7-hydroxytetralin may exhibit properties such as being a weak base due to the amino group and can participate in hydrogen bonding due to the hydroxyl group. Its unique structure and functional groups make it a subject of interest in medicinal chemistry and neuropharmacology.
Formula:C10H13NO
